Affected products
Prestone Ice and Frost Shield, Model 70912
Product description
Prestone Ice and Frost Shield, Model 70912
Hazard identified
This consumer product does not meet child-resistant packaging requirements for consumer chemical products under the Consumer Chemicals and Containers Regulations, 2001 under the Canada Consumer Product Safety Act.
The consumer product does not have proper child resistant packaging required by the Consumer Chemicals and Containers Regulations, 2001 under the Canada Consumer Product Safety Act. The improper packaging could result in unintentional exposure to these products and lead to serious illness, injury & death.
Neither Health Canada nor Prestone has received consumer incident reports related to the use of this product.
Number sold
Approximately 21,100 units of the recalled products were sold at various retail locations in Canada.
Time period sold
The recalled products were sold in Canada between September 2011 and August 2015.
Place of origin
Manufactured in the USA.

What you should do
Consumers should immediately stop using the recalled product and call 1-800-890-2075, Option 4 for more information about the recall.
Please note that the Canada Consumer Product Safety Act prohibits recalled products from being redistributed, sold or even given away in Canada.
